When the evidence behind a decision cannot be traced or tested, society pays twice: good programmes can lose funding while weaker ones keep theirs. Evidence that holds up to scrutiny lets us invest with confidence in what truly works.
We understand the pressure. Most methods start with average values from a table and apply them one topic at a time. The result is the same benefit counted twice, missing pathways, and numbers that change depending on how the question was framed. You deserve social value measured across every relevant topic at once, person by person, in one connected model - not separate estimates added together after the fact.
